The Challenge

I successfully completed 30 races in the 12 months leading up to what would have been Adam Bramwell’s 30th birthday on 18th November 2018.

To raise awareness for mental health, raising a grand total of £15,461 for 3 charities working endlessly to break the stigma and support those suffering, to conduct further research into mental health and also help those that have lost loved ones to suicide.

The blog now covers all things running, mental health and suicide bereavement.
